Component Identification
7
1. Fuel Tank Cap: Remove the fuel tank cap to add fuel once engine has cooled.
2. Fuel Tank: Storage for gasoline to power the engine.
3. Throttle Knob: Adjust the engine speed with the throttle knob.
4. Engine Start/Stop Button (Only Electric Start Model): Push button start/stop switch (Electric Start Model
Only)
5. Starter Recoil Handle: Pull the Starter Recoil handle to start the engine.
6. Spark Plug: Ignites compressed fuel and air within the combustion chamber of the engine.
7. Air Cleaner: Prevents dust and debris from entering the engine.
8. Muffler: The muffler reduces noise from engine. It will become hot during operation, do not touch.
9. Oil Drain Bolt: Remove oil drain bolt to drain oil from the engine. See Maintenance section of this manual.
10. Oil Dipstick: Remove oil dipstick and inspect to ensure proper oil level in engine.
11. Serial Number: Unique engine serial number etched into the engine block.
12. Engine Switch: Switch that turns the engine on and off.
13. Electric Starter Motor (Electric Start Model Only): Device which starts without pulling the recoil.
14. Battery Box (Recoil Start Models Only): Holds 2- 9V batteries to power ECU and fuel pump upon initial
starting.
15. NorthStar Illuminated Logo: Illuminates when Engine Switch is turned On
